Course Details

• Advanced Biodiversity Assessment: This unit will cover the latest methods and tools for conducting comprehensive biodiversity assessments, including the use of remote sensing, GIS, and genetics.<br> • Climate Change Mitigation and Adaptation: This unit will focus on the strategies and techniques for mitigating and adapting to climate change, including the role of renewable energy, energy efficiency, and carbon sequestration.<br> • Conservation Biology: This unit will provide an in-depth understanding of the principles and practices of conservation biology, including population dynamics, habitat fragmentation, and genetic diversity.<br> • Ecosystem-based Management: This unit will cover the approaches and tools for managing ecosystems, including the use of marine protected areas, sustainable fisheries management, and restoration ecology.<br> • Environmental Policy and Law: This unit will provide an understanding of the legal and policy frameworks that govern conservation efforts, including international agreements, national legislation, and local regulations.<br> • Global Change and Conservation: This unit will explore the impacts of global change on biodiversity and ecosystems, including habitat loss, invasive species, and pollution.<br> • Human Dimensions of Conservation: This unit will examine the social, economic, and cultural factors that influence conservation efforts, including community-based conservation, protected area management, and environmental education.<br> • Protected Area Management: This unit will cover the principles and practices of protected area management, including the design, planning, and implementation of protected areas.<br> • Sustainable Development and Conservation: This unit will explore the relationship between sustainable development and conservation, including the challenges and opportunities for balancing economic growth and environmental protection.<br> • Wildlife Conservation and Management: This unit will provide an understanding of the principles and practices of wildlife conservation and management, including population dynamics, habitat management, and human-wildlife conflict.<br>
